Output 817d8102076e705404112ddef6cafe1694d6a22a3181636ef9bf6960a10845f8:0

value
20649431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fe2df3daa72a9d75b1bbfe25be32fc190f61e79 OP_EQUAL
address
3LeDabdq3HcqkKXk4okzkS8UFZechLJcNv
transaction
817d8102076e705404112ddef6cafe1694d6a22a3181636ef9bf6960a10845f8
spent
true